It is the third book in Ferrante's Neapolitan Novels series, which chronicles the friendship between two women—Elena Greco and Raffaella "Lila" Cerullo—from childhood to old age in a poor neighborhood of Naples, Italy. In Those Who Leave and Those Who Stay, the third Neapolitan novel, Elena and Lila, the two girls whom readers first met in My Brilliant Friend, have become women. Elena has left the neighborhood, earned her college degree, and published a successful novel, all of which have opened the doors to a world of learned interlocutors and richly furnished salons.
